Output 8a10e82de9f0bb77443c3f5cd8e2a579d1f3f441db05267640c251c94170b49e:0

value
1087893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 858efd706a4bf41a74c5905f41259c3158ae33c8 OP_EQUAL
address
3DsD6BBSrp1SPyja6UtbVKmWjVR5g6UQKD
transaction
8a10e82de9f0bb77443c3f5cd8e2a579d1f3f441db05267640c251c94170b49e
confirmations
164599
spent
true